It is fascinating to note the astute observations of clinicians almost a century ago. Familial hematuria was described in 1902 by Dr. Leonard Guthrie. Dr. Cecil Alport refined the disease description in 1927. (Both papers are still available online.) Applications for life insurance were recently received on two women who had Alport syndrome as a known diagnosis. The cases will be presented and used as a...
